Transaction ec7a229ea143fc489577d7ebb4d0d0de9aaf8efd61db939532e7ae5d98ded8cb
1 Input
1 Output
-
ec7a229ea143fc489577d7ebb4d0d0de9aaf8efd61db939532e7ae5d98ded8cb:0
- value
- 807186311
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 a21bdf2733a7eba44c9edf3eb6cb90443586b7df O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Fn9rdsGbkX34BEDx12BxSp1oBsm7g3Roj